From: Emmanuele Bassi Date: Wed, 14 Jan 2009 15:30:10 +0000 (+0000) Subject: Emit ::load-finished for every texture load X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=5d346cca5705c5c3fc21444b8c9c758f55b0bc67;p=profile%2Fivi%2Fclutter.git Emit ::load-finished for every texture load The ::load-finished signal is emitted only when loading a texture using clutter_texture_set_from_file(). Since this breaks user expectations and consistency, we should also emit ::load-finished when loading a texture from image data. --- diff --git a/clutter/clutter-texture.c b/clutter/clutter-texture.c index a3b1bd3..d081b38 100644 --- a/clutter/clutter-texture.c +++ b/clutter/clutter-texture.c @@ -1270,6 +1270,8 @@ clutter_texture_set_from_data (ClutterTexture *texture, cogl_texture_unref (new_texture); + g_signal_emit (texture, texture_signals[LOAD_FINISHED], 0, error); + return TRUE; }